It Is Never Too Late to Begin Again

“How wonderful it is that nobody need wait a single moment before starting to improve the world.”

—ANNE FRANK

It is because of the Lord’s mercy and loving-kindness that we are not consumed, because His [tender] compassions fail not. They are new every morning; great and abundant is Your stability and faithfulness.

—Lamentations 3:22–23

Hopelessness is a burden none of us needs to endure because, with God, it is never too late to begin again. He is the God of new beginnings. Jonah went in the opposite direction of the one God instructed, but God let him have a fresh start once he admitted his mistake.

It is never too late to pray and ask for God’s help and forgiveness. The devil wants us to feel hopeless. He loves words like “never” and “the end.” He says, “This is the end of everything. You have messed up and can never overcome your bad choices.” We must remember to look to God’s Word for truth, because the devil is a liar.

The Bible is filled with stories about people who experienced new beginnings. Receiving Jesus as our Savior is the ultimate new beginning. We become new creatures with an opportunity to learn a new way of living. The Bible even says in Ephesians 4:23 that we must be constantly renewed in our minds and attitudes. If you ever thought or displayed an attitude thinking it was too late for you to have a good life, good relationships, or hope for the future, then you need to renew your mind right away. Choose to think according to God’s Word and not how you feel. Nobody is a failure unless they choose to stop trying. Life gets a lot sweeter and easier if we live with the attitude that says, “I will do my best today and I trust God will do the rest. Tomorrow I will begin again and I will never quit or give up.”
